{"version":"2.5","id":"seatac-thrifty-security-deposit-policies","question":"What are Thrifty's security deposit and debit card policies at SeaTac Rental Car Facility?","answer":"Thrifty at SeaTac requires a security deposit, with varying hold amounts and refund timelines based on payment method and rental tier.","answer_detail":"When renting a car from Thrifty at SeaTac, customers should be aware of the security deposit policies. For credit card users, the hold amount varies based on the vehicle category, typically ranging from $200 to $500. For debit card users, the hold amount can be significantly higher, often between $500 to $1000, depending on the rental tier and vehicle type. Refund timelines also differ; for certain tiers, refunds can take 30 to 60 business days to process. Thrifty accepts major debit cards, but specific criteria must be met, including sufficient available funds and a valid government-issued ID. It's recommended to check with Thrifty directly for the most up-to-date information on their policies, as they are subject to change. Customers should also plan accordingly, ensuring they have available credit or funds to cover the potential hold amount. For example, a customer renting an economy car with a debit card might expect a $500 hold, while a luxury vehicle could result in a $1000 hold. Understanding these policies can help avoid any unexpected issues during the rental process.","related_ids":["seatac-thrifty-security-deposit-policies"],"last_verified":"2026-06-06","authority":"https://www.seatacrentalcarfacility.com","url":"https://www.seatacrentalcarfacility.com/en/knowledge/seatac-thrifty-security-deposit-policies","markdown_url":"https://www.seatacrentalcarfacility.com/api/knowledge/seatac-thrifty-security-deposit-policies?format=md&lang=en"}
